FNQ (Cairns) Sub-Branch Golf Day

FNQ Cairns Golf Day
Don't miss the Annual IQA FNQ Sub-Branch Golf Day.

 

Dust off those clubs and prepare for a day of networking on the range. 

REGISTRATIONS NOW OPEN

Date: Friday 24 May 2024
Time: 11:00am - 7:00pm (approx.)
Venue: Cairns Golf Club | Links Drive, Woree QLD | Directions here

Put together a team of 4 or nominate individually to compete in the IQA's FNQ Sub-Branch Golf Day competition! 

This will be a fun filled day of spirited competition among your colleagues and peers as well as a great opportunity to socialise and network. 

Golf teams will consist of 4 players in a 4 ball ambrose with a shotgun start, playing 18 holes. Pairs and individual players will be placed in a team on the day. 

We would like to encourage a Young Member Network (YMN) and Women In Quarrying (WIQ) team. Put one together yourself or come along individually and the IQA will place you in a team. What a great way to meet new people!

Program: 

11:00am    Event commences | Player registration and lunch 
11:45am   Player briefing 
12 noon   Tee off | Shotgun start
5:00pm   Presentation & post game refreshments 
7:00pm   Event concludes 

 

Registration: 
Team of 4 players: $500.00
Individual players: $125.00
Additional post-game tickets: $60.00
The player costs includes, green fees for 18 holes, golf cart (one cart shared between 2 players), lunch, four complimentary drink vouchers (excluding UDL), nibbles and post game drinks.
